“I always wanted to be a doctor, even from a young age,” wrote Lovera Wolf Miller, MD.
“I was inspired by my father who was an anesthesiologist, and empowered by my artist mother,” she said.
After majoring in biology as an undergraduate at Andrews University in Michigan, Wolf Miller went to medical school at Loma Linda University in Southern California, and completed her specialty residency in Obstetrics and Gynecology at Glendale Adventist Medical Center in Los Angeles.
